Full court reference for LHC outgoing Chief Justice Ameer Bhatti to be held tomorrow

Chief Justice Lahore High Court Justice Muhammad Ameer Bhatti will retire from service on Thursday (tomorrow), reported 24NewsHD TV channel.

The full court reference in honor of outgoing chief justice will be held tomorrow. Nominated Chief Justice LHC Justice Malik Shahzad Ahmad Khan and other judges of the high court will attend the reference.

After the approval of LCH CJ Ameer Bhatti revised roasters of judges was issued for today and tomorrow.

Chief Justice Ameer Bhatti and Justice Malik Shahzad will hear the cases on principal seat. Justice Shujaat Ali, Justice Ali Baqir Najfi, Justice Aalia Neelam, Justice Abid Aziz, Justice Shahid Bilal, Justice Sadaqat Ali Khan, Justice Shams Mehmood, Justice Shahbaz Ali Rizvi and others will hear the cases on principal seat.
